Beltway bandit is a term for private companies located in or near Washington, D.C., whose major business is to provide consulting services to the US government.The phrase was originally a mild insult, implying that the companies preyed like bandits on the largesse of the federal government, but it has lost much of its pejorative nature and is now often used as a neutral, descriptive term. Then in 2005, a congressional report found that of 286 schools scheduled to be built in Afghanistan by the Louis Berger Group for USAID, only eight were built by the end of the year; only 15 of 253 health clinics the company promised were completed over the same time period. In 2004, the then Afghan Finance Minister Ashraf Ghani was so flustered by the poor performance of BearingPoint consultants that he he asked a number of them to leave the country. Yet even the bigger, technical projects assigned to private contractors face criticism, since USAID lacks the manpower to oversee how their money is spent. Their selling point is that they can execute aid contracts—for food and water delivery, new roads, schools and hospitals—more cost-effectively than either NGOs or the federal government. The upshot: private contractors are better suited to build infrastructure like roads and bridges because of their size and technical expertise; they're at their worst when tasked with smaller, local operations like schools and health clinics, which require the time and patience to build local trust. Education, space exploration and foreign aid are just a few of the government operations the Bush administration has privatized during its tenure, turning the outskirts of Washington into a sea of private firms that live off public contracts. Today there are 109 USAID staff managing upwards of $8.9 billion in aid funds, about $81 million per staff member.
